What is another word for block off?

Need synonyms for block off? Here's a list of similar words from our thesaurus that you can use instead.

Verb
To close or cordon off an area, such as with a barricade
“In any investigation, police officers block off the crime scene so that evidence can be collected.”
Verb
To close or clog an opening
“Using the tarp from his trunk, he could block off the hole in the wall.”
Verb
To cover or hide from view
